Louisiana’s U.S. Senate runoff is heating up. Dr. John Fleming, LA State Treasurer & Candidate for US Senate, joins Dave for an in-depth conversation as he faces Julia Letlow in the runoff election. Why does he believe he’s the right choice for Louisiana? And what about the claims being made in negative campaign ads? Did John really want to bus illegal immigrants into the country? Dave asks the tough questions before you head to the polls.

Full Show 6/8/2026: President Trump has to find a win for America out of this US/Iran conflict

On today's show, Newell has on Mike Giorlando, the new athletic director at UNO, to talk about overseeing the transition to the LSU system and leading the Privateers into a new future, Amber Northern, Senior Vice President for Research at the Thomas B. Fordham Institute, to discuss a new report showing teacher union membership has declined across the country, Aaron David Miller, a Senior Fellow at the Carnegie Endowment for International Peace, to break down the latest developments involving Iran, John Scott, Special Agent in Charge of the DEA New Orleans Field Division, went over the drug threats our area faces and the strategies being used to keep our communities safe, and Guy Williams, Chairman & CEO, Gulf Coast Bank & Trust, to discuss the shocking jobs report, SpaceX’s big IPO, California’s minimum wage hike starting to hurt, and shippers facing shortages with trucking rates higher.
